How they compare

Ghana currently reports 124.81 % against 61.19 % in Europe, a difference of 63.62 %.

That makes Ghana's figure about 2.0 times Europe's.

Across all 63 years both countries report, Ghana has been ahead every year.

Europe ranks 13th and Ghana ranks 14th of 32 groups.

Ghana has averaged higher in every one of the 7 decades both report.

Head to head by decade

Decade Europe Ghana Difference Ahead
1960s 35.94 % 152.54 % 116.6 % Ghana
1970s 30.36 % 109.04 % 78.68 % Ghana
1980s 27.99 % 89.07 % 61.08 % Ghana
1990s 39.08 % 118 % 78.92 % Ghana
2000s 49.04 % 112.85 % 63.81 % Ghana
2010s 54.21 % 110.48 % 56.26 % Ghana
2020s 59.29 % 121.11 % 61.82 % Ghana

Averages of every year both report within each decade.

The Cropland Nutrient balance domain contains information on the flows of nitrogen, phosphorus, and potassium from mineral fertilizer, manure applied, atmospheric deposition, crop removal, and biological fixation over cropland and per unit area of cropland. The flows are aggregated to total inputs and total outputs, from which the overall nutrient balance and nutrient use efficiency on cropland are calculated. Statistics are disseminated in units of tonnes and in kg/ha, as appropriate. Nutrient use efficiency is expressed as a fraction (%).
